The PKK terrorist organization, which has been carrying out armed attacks against Turkey for 40 years, burned its weapons yesterday in a symbolic ceremony held in Sulaymaniyah, Iraq. President Recep Tayyip Erdoğan's historic"Turkey Without Terrorism" speech at his party's 32nd Consultation and Evaluation Meeting in Kızılcahamam was closely followed by the world press.

The American news agency AP, which included President Erdoğan's statements, described this process as"the end of a painful era" in its news report.

'A GAIN FOR Türkiye'

The French news agency AFP also covered President Erdoğan's speech and evaluated the PKK's disarmament as a gain for Türkiye.

'BEGINNING OF THE NEW ERA'

Israeli media outlets such as the Times of Israel and the Jerusalem Post reported that President Erdoğan supported the PKK's disarmament process and emphasized that this was the beginning of a new era for Türkiye.

'86 MILLION CITIZENS WON'

The French RFI news agency quoted President Erdoğan as saying,"Türkiye won, 86 million citizens won," detailing the PKK's symbolic arms laying down ceremony and Türkiye's strategy for the future.

'AN IMPORTANT WIN'

The Italian Quotidiano Nazionale, on the other hand, wrote that President Erdoğan, in his speech, stated that Turkey saw this process as a victory and that an important gain had been achieved after many years.

'A NEW PAGE HAS BEEN OPENED'

Lebanon-based LBCI Lebanon reported that President Erdoğan said that"a new page has opened" for Türkiye after the PKK's weapons surrender process began.

Iran-based Mehr News Agency also announced that President Erdoğan welcomed the PKK's disarmament process as"an important step towards ending terrorism."

'ON THE PATH OF PEACE AND STABILITY'

US-based FOX 59 television also reported that President Erdoğan emphasized that the start of the terrorist organization PKK's disarmament process was a historic step towards peace and stability.

'THE DOORS OF THE NEW ERA HAVE OPENED'

The Greece-based Protothema newspaper reported President Erdoğan's statements to its readers under the headline"The doors of a new era have opened in Turkey."

'HISTORICAL THRESHOLD'

Another Greek newspaper, Kathimerini, described President Erdoğan's statements and the PKK terrorist organization's disarmament as"a historic threshold for Türkiye."

'THE DOORS OF A STRONG Türkiye HAVE BEEN OPENED'

The Spanish newspaper Democrata reported President Erdoğan’s statements, emphasizing that “the doors of a strong Türkiye have been thrown wide open” and described the PKK’s disarmament process as “the end of a tragic era.”

'HISTORICAL PROCESS'

Dubai-based Al Arabiya also quoted President Erdoğan's statements, stating that Türkiye is going through a historic process.
